
In an unprecedented move that bridges the worlds of anime and professional sports, One Piece, the globally celebrated manga and anime series, has officially announced a groundbreaking partnership with Major League Baseball’s Los Angeles Dodgers. This collaboration marks a unique fusion of pop culture and sports entertainment, signaling a fresh and exciting chapter for fans of both franchises. The partnership is poised to bring together two vibrant communities, creating innovative fan experiences, merchandise, and special events that highlight the shared spirit of adventure, teamwork, and passion.
The announcement came during a high-energy press event in downtown Los Angeles, where representatives from Toei Animation, the production company behind One Piece, joined forces with the Dodgers’ executives to unveil the details of this new alliance. This collaboration will introduce a variety of initiatives designed to engage fans on multiple levels. Central to the partnership are limited-edition merchandise collections that feature beloved characters from One Piece donning Dodgers-themed gear. These exclusive items include jerseys, caps, collectible figurines, and apparel that blend the distinct aesthetics of the anime with the Dodgers’ iconic blue and white colors. Early reveals of these products have already generated significant buzz, with fans eager to snag these rare items that celebrate their dual fandom.
Moreover, the partnership includes a series of interactive events hosted at Dodger Stadium, where attendees can immerse themselves in One Piece-themed experiences. These events will feature life-sized statues of Luffy and his crew scattered throughout the ballpark, themed photo booths, and special in-game moments where players and mascots will engage in One Piece-inspired celebrations. Fans will also have the opportunity to participate in trivia contests and giveaways that highlight both One Piece lore and Dodgers history, creating a dynamic environment for engagement and fun.
The integration of One Piece content will extend into digital platforms as well. The Dodgers plan to roll out a special One Piece section on their official website and mobile app, where fans can access exclusive behind-the-scenes content, interviews with creators, and even watch select episodes and clips of the anime.
